Rescue workers pressed their search Thursday across Turkey and Syria for survivors from this week's massive earthquake and aftershocks as the window to find people alive began to close.

Turkey's government said that in addition to more than 16,000 people killed, more than 64,000 have been injured. In Syria, more than 3,100 have been reported dead and more than 5,000 injured.

On Wednesday, Turkey's President Recep Tayyip Erdogan visited Kahramanmaras, a city near the epicenter of the quake, telling survivors that"we are face to face with a great disaster." There is growing public anger that the rescue response has been slow, and Erdogan acknowledged there were shortfalls by his government in the immediate aftermath of the quake.
